# Build Provenance: Report Export Timezones

Plugin authors for the Quillforge reporting platform should note that all export jobs are rendered in UTC internally, then shifted to the workspace timezone at serialization time. Your plugin must never apply its own offset, or daylight-saving transitions will double-shift timestamps. Every export bundle embeds provenance metadata identifying the exact builder image and ruleset version used. When reporting discrepancies, always include the provenance token recorded below.

pipeline stamp: htk9_ce63042d9

## Releases

The Spindlebrook barcode module ships as a signed plugin for the Cartwheel POS terminal. Each release is built in an isolated runner, checksummed, and verified against the previous manifest before publication. Unsigned builds are rejected at install time by design. For audit purposes, the deploy key used to sign current releases is recorded below.

deploy key for kahof-tadup: bky4_rRMZ

## Changelog — Driftline Gateway 3.8.2

Key rotation performed alongside the websocket reconnect fix. Clients on 3.8.1 and earlier dropped connections during token refresh and failed to reconnect; 3.8.2 resolves this. The old release signing key is retired immediately — builds signed with it will fail verification after this release. Support: advise customers updating manually to verify downloads against the new key. All 3.8.2 artifacts are signed with the key below.

rollout seal: bky4_x7Gc

Snapshot tests for Lanternkit components run via the /snapshots/compare endpoint. Failures during deploy page on-call automatically. To re-baseline, POST the build ID with force=false first; only force after visual review. All requests require the internal render-farm credential in the X-Lantern-Auth header. For emergency re-runs, authenticate with the key below.

gateway credential: vxb4-QTMv

## Onboarding Note: Wireloom Compression Review

Wireloom's websocket layer supports per-message deflate. We disable context takeover on untrusted channels to limit compression-oracle exposure, trading bandwidth for safety. As security reviewer, please confirm the config matrix before each release is signed and published. Release verification on your end should use the publishing key that follows.

deploy key for kajof-fajop: bky6_gDHw9Q